Optimizing Soil Density with Vibrating Compactors

Vibrating compactors are essential equipment for achieving optimal soil density in various construction and engineering applications. These dynamic devices utilize oscillations to effectively consolidate loose soil particles, creating a more stable foundation. By minimizing air pockets within the soil profile, vibrating compactors improve its strength and bearing capacity. This is particularly crucial for projects requiring durability, such as road construction, building foundations, and land development.

  • Furthermore, vibrating compactors can help to ensure proper soil drainage by promoting the interlocking of particles. This prevents waterlogging and promotes thriving plant growth in agricultural settings.
  • Optimal compaction also helps to reduce subsidence over time, which can lead to costly repairs and structural damage.

Choosing the appropriate vibratory compactor for a specific project depends on factors such as soil type, depth of solidification required, and site accessibility.

Soil Compaction Essentials: Choosing the Right Machine Selecting the Optimal

When it comes to achieving dense soil compaction for construction or landscaping projects, selecting the right machine is paramount. Factors like project scale, soil type, and financial constraints will influence your choice. For smaller areas, a walk-behind plate compactor may suffice, while larger projects often demand a ride-on roller. Research different brands and models to identify the best fit for your specific needs.

  • Plate Compactors: Ideal for smaller areas, footpaths, and driveways.
  • Rammers: Effective for densifying hard-to-reach areas and uneven surfaces.
  • Ride-On Rollers: Designed for large-scale projects, offering greater compaction efficiency.

Remember to consult a professional for expert advice on selecting the most appropriate soil compaction machine for your project's unique characteristics.

Plate Compactor Operation and Maintenance Guide

Operating and maintaining your plate compactor properly is essential for successful performance and a longer lifespan. Before you begin operation, carefully review the manufacturer's manual. Ensure the compactor is in sound working condition and check all components for any damage or wear.

During operation, keep a safe distance from the compactor's path. Don appropriate safety gear, containing gloves, eye protection, and hearing earmuffs.

Consistent maintenance is essential to prevent downtime and costly repairs. This includes examining the oil and fuel levels regularly, cleaning the air filter, and greasing moving parts as instructed by the manufacturer.

  • Record all maintenance tasks and the dates they were performed. This will help you track the compactor's service history and identify potential issues early on.
  • House your plate compactor in a covered location when not in use. This will protect it from the elements and lengthen its lifespan.
